This is delicious yet easy to make. Best of all, it can be made several days ahead since it will keep for 3 weeks refrigerated or up to 3 months frozen.
Ingredients
- 12 ounces fresh or frozen cranberries
- 0.75 cups white sugar
- 1 , 12 ounce
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ice
- 0.75 cups chopped walnuts
Instructions
-
1
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). Place cranberries in a shallow 1 1/2 quart baking dish. Sprinkle with sugar, cover with foil and bake for 35 minutes.
-
2
Remove from oven and sprinkle with walnuts. Re-cover and bake for 10 minutes.
-
3
Remove from oven and stir in marmalade and lemon juice. Mix well. Cool to room temperature. Cover tightly and refrigerate at least 3 hours before serving.
